| | | George E. Henderson, age 92 of West Pine Street, Coshocton died Sunday, September 6, 2009 in Coshocton. He was born on March 9, 1917 in Salineville, OH, the son of the late Eva (Rowe) and Walter Henderson.
He graduated from Salineville High School and worked as an auto mechanic for 45 years for Orwig Motors in Alliance. After retiring he worked on cars at his home for several years.
He was a gentle, polite and sweet man, all the ladies loved to give him hugs. He was a part of the 7:30 mens club at the High Rise where he lived. He was a man of deep faith and he would spend hours every morning praying and reading the Bible. He attended the Burt Avenue Wesleyan Church of Coshocton.
In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his wife, Olive (Waltz) Henderson who died May 4, 1987; he then married Fern (Watson) Henderson on July 7, 1988 and she died in 1994; son, Richard; and brothers and sisters.
He is survived by his daughter-in-law, Alice Henderson of Mt. Vernon; one brother, Allen Henderson and wife Agnes of Alliance; two sisters, Martha Myers of Alliance, Mabel Morgan and husband, Larry of Washington.
